What is a Jackpot Aggregator?
At its core, a jackpot aggregator is a backend software option that pools stakes from multiple video games, platforms, or online casinos into a single, enormous progressive prize.
Instead of a jackpot growing exclusively from the bets placed by players on Casino A's variation of a Slot Games Aggregator, an aggregated prize grows from the bets of gamers across Casino A, B, C, and D all playing the same networked game.
Since the gamer pool is exponentially bigger, the prize meter climbs up at an astonishing rate, frequently reaching millions of euros or dollars in a matter of days.

The Future of Jackpot Aggregation
As the iGaming market continues to develop, prize aggregators are ending up being a lot more versatile. We are starting to see cross-provider aggregators, where prizes are pooled not just across numerous gambling establishments, however throughout games created by completely various software studios.
Moreover, the combination of gamification features-- such as "must-drop" day-to-day jackpots, hourly timers, and community-shared prizes where a percentage of a mega-win goes to current players-- is keeping engagement at an all-time high.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the distinction between a local prize and an aggregated prize?
A regional jackpot is tied solely to one casino or a specific group of gambling establishments owned by the very same brand. An aggregated (or network) prize swimming pools bets from players throughout hundreds of totally independent online casinos, leading to much larger and faster-growing reward pools.
2. Are jackpot aggregator video games rigged?
No. Genuine prize aggregators are developed by certified software companies and tested by independent third-party auditing agencies (such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s). The outcomes are identified by licensed Random Number Generators (RNGs), ensuring total fairness.
3. Do I require to wager maximum total up to win an aggregated jackpot?
Not necessarily. While some older progressive slots required max bets to receive the prize, modern aggregated games often offer players an equivalent opportunity of activating the prize on any spin, though the possibility may scale proportionally with bet size depending upon the specific game guidelines.
4. Who actually pays out the prize when somebody wins?
Depending on the network structure, the payment is usually funded by the collected swimming pool handled by the game provider or aggregator, rather than out of the pocket of the private casino where the gamer struck the win.
